需求:最近组里有这样一个需求,大概就是用代码生成代码(这里的代码指的是C代码,其中有一大部分是重复的格式)。实际工作当中,如果手动自行去复制-->粘贴-->修改-->调试,大概率会调试不通过,问题多半出现在'修改'这个一环节。比如有时候少粘贴个';' ,这样的小失误会徒增我们码农的麻烦(最重要的是不能早点下班~~哈哈),所以这个小程序就出来了。一 、准备工作python基础xlw
转载
2024-10-30 06:37:24
58阅读
# Java 生成 XML 文件去掉 Tab
在 Java 程序中,我们经常需要生成 XML 文件。然而,默认情况下,生成的 XML 文件中会包含制表符(Tab)字符,这使得 XML 文件的可读性下降。本文将介绍如何使用 Java 生成 XML 文件时去掉 Tab 字符。
## 1. 什么是 XML?
XML(eXtensible Markup Language,可扩展标记语言)是一种用于存
原创
2023-08-28 10:03:35
78阅读
对于程序员来说,其实Tab和空格远远不只是“立场”问题那么简单。在不同的编辑器里tab的长度可能不一致,所以在一个编辑器里用tab设置缩进后,在其它编辑器里看可能缩进就乱了。空格不会出现这个问题,因为空格就占一个字符的位置。众所周知,Tab在ASCII码中,编码是9,而空格是32。这也就是说,当我们按下一个Tab的时候,即使它看起来就是8个空格(或者4个空格,不同的环境下,Tab可能显示的效果不同
# 生成XML文件去掉tab和空格
在Java中,我们经常需要生成XML文件来存储和传输数据。但是,在生成XML文件时,有时候会出现不需要的Tab和空格,这可能会导致XML文件变得混乱和难以阅读。因此,本文将介绍如何使用Java生成XML文件,并在生成过程中去掉Tab和空格,以保持XML文件的清晰和简洁。
## 什么是XML
XML(eXtensible Markup Language)是一
原创
2023-09-01 11:49:06
310阅读
## Python如何返回Tab
在Python中,返回Tab主要有两种常用方法:使用制表符(Tab)字符和使用转义字符`\t`。下面将详细介绍这两种方法,并提供相应的代码示例。
### 方法一:使用制表符(Tab)字符
制表符是一种特殊字符,可以用于在文本中创建固定间距的缩进。在Python中,可以使用制表符字符`\t`来表示Tab。
下面是一个简单的示例,演示如何使用制表符字符返回Ta
原创
2023-12-11 14:05:40
39阅读
# 如何在Python中使用Tab输出
在Python中,使用`print()`函数来输出内容是非常常见的操作。当我们需要在输出中添加制表符(Tab)时,可以通过`\t`来实现。本文将介绍如何在Python中使用Tab输出,并给出一些示例来帮助理解。
## 什么是Tab?
在计算机术语中,Tab是一个控制字符,用来在文本中创建水平间距,通常等同于四个空格的宽度。在Python中,`\t`表示
原创
2024-02-23 07:44:01
129阅读
本文主要向大家介绍了Python语言之写码时应该缩进使用 tab 还是空格?,通过具体的内容向大家展示,希望对大家学习Python语言有所帮助。在不同的编辑器里tab的长度可能不一致,所以在一个编辑器里用tab设置缩进后,在其它编辑器里看可能缩进就乱了。空格不会出现这个问题,因为空格就占一个字符的位置。对于程序员来说,其实Tab和空格远远不只是“立场”问题那么简单。众所周知,Tab在ASCII码中
转载
2023-07-28 21:35:49
175阅读
1)Numpy能够读写磁盘上的文本数据或二进制数据。将数组以二进制格式保存到磁盘np.load和np.save是读写磁盘数组数据的两个主要函数,默认情况下,数组是以未压缩的原始二进制格式保存在扩展名为.npy的文件中。import numpy as np
a=np.arange(5)
np.save('test.npy',a)这样在程序所在的文件夹就生成了一个test.npy文件将test.npy
转载
2023-06-25 17:31:46
768阅读
Tab键tabulator key 的缩写,意思是跳格键。基本用法是可以用来绘制无边框的表格,还可以在单词间留下间隔,一般等于八个空格的长度。但是您知道电脑Tab键有什么功能吗?以下一些关于Tab键的使用和功能的介绍,希望这些可以为您带来便捷的上网体验。操作环境:
演示机型:华硕X8AE43In-SL
系统版本:Windows 10
一、切换窗口使用【Alt+Tab】可以快速切换窗口。
转载
2024-06-02 10:58:17
95阅读
一、简介py2exe是一个将python脚本转换成windows上的可独立执行的可执行程序(*.exe)的工具,这样,你就可以不用装python而在windows系统上运行这个可执行程序。py2exe已经被用于创建wxPython,Tkinter,Pmw,PyGTK,pygame,win32com client和server,和其它的独立程序。py2exe是发布在开源许可证下的。目前只有pytho
转载
2024-07-27 13:09:40
41阅读
# 如何使用Python合并多个TAB文件
在数据分析和处理的过程中,合并多个TAB分隔的文件是一个常见的任务。如果你是一个刚入行的开发者,可能会对如何实现这一过程感到困惑。本篇文章将详细讲解如何使用Python来合并多个TAB文件,并提供必要的代码示例和解释。
## 整体过程
合并TAB文件的过程可以概括为以下几个步骤:
| 步骤 | 描述
# Python给文件写入Tab的实现流程
## 1. 确定文件路径和文件名
首先,我们需要确定要操作的文件的路径和文件名。可以使用绝对路径或相对路径来指定文件的位置。
## 2. 打开文件
接下来,我们需要使用Python的内置函数`open()`来打开文件,并创建一个文件对象,以便后续的读写操作。在打开文件时,需要指定文件的路径、文件名和打开模式。
```python
file =
原创
2023-11-08 05:38:09
106阅读
# Python文件写入tab键
在Python中,我们经常需要将数据写入文件。有时候,我们希望在写入文件时使用tab键来对数据进行分隔,以便在其他程序中读取文件时能够方便地处理数据。本文将介绍如何使用Python写入带有tab键的文件,并提供相关的代码示例。
## 写入带有tab键的文件
Python提供了多种方式来写入文件,其中包括使用内建函数`open()`和使用`with`语句。下面
原创
2023-10-22 05:52:32
393阅读
在使用 Source Insight 编辑 Python 代码时,较常见的问题之一是如何配置制表符(Tab)设置。这不仅影响代码的可读性,也可能导致不同编码环境下的兼容性问题。本篇文章将详细阐述该问题的处理流程。
问题场景
在以 Source Insight 为主的代码编辑环境中,Python 文件的制表符设置容易出现问题,可能导致代码在不同开发环境中格式错乱。对此类问题的理解,对日常的开发工
## Python写Tab到文件的实现步骤
在Python中将数据以Tab的形式写入文件可以使用`'\t'`作为分隔符,然后利用文件操作函数将数据写入文件中。下面是实现这个过程的具体步骤,可以用表格展示:
| 步骤 | 描述 |
| --- | --- |
| 步骤一 | 打开文件 |
| 步骤二 | 写入数据 |
| 步骤三 | 关闭文件 |
接下来我将逐步介绍每个步骤需要做的事情,包括需
原创
2023-12-06 06:43:48
89阅读
# Python如何生成nc文件
## 引言
nc文件是一种常用的数据格式,它通常用于存储科学数据,尤其是与地理空间相关的数据。生成nc文件可以通过使用Python中的netCDF4库来实现。在本文中,我们将介绍如何使用Python生成nc文件,并解决一个实际问题。
## 什么是nc文件
nc文件是一种自包含的、可扩展的、支持多维数据的文件格式。它通常用于存储大规模的科学数据,特别是地理空间数
原创
2023-09-07 11:26:03
1398阅读
# 如何生成STL文件(二进制三角网格文件)使用Python
STL(Standard Tessellation Language)文件是一种常见的三维模型文件格式,用于表示三维模型的表面几何形状。在本文中,我们将探讨如何使用Python生成STL文件的过程,并提供一个实际问题的解决方案。
## 什么是STL文件
STL文件是一种用于表示三维模型的二进制或文本格式文件,通常包含三角形网格的信
原创
2024-06-13 06:51:45
361阅读
# Python如何生成DLL文件
在Python中,我们可以使用C/C++来扩展Python的功能并生成DLL(Dynamic-Link Library)文件。DLL文件是一种在Windows操作系统中用来共享函数和资源的文件类型,它可以被其他应用程序动态链接调用。生成DLL文件可以使我们在其他编程语言中使用Python代码。
在本文中,我们将介绍如何使用Python生成DLL文件,包括以下
原创
2024-01-14 09:03:43
1040阅读
# 使用Python写入tab分隔的txt文件的方案
在Python中,我们可以使用`'\t'`作为分隔符来创建tab分隔的txt文件。下面是一个具体的问题,以及解决方案的代码示例。
## 问题描述:
假设我们有一个学生信息的列表,每个学生有姓名、年龄和成绩三个属性。我们希望将这些学生信息写入一个tab分隔的txt文件,以便在其他应用程序中进行处理和分析。
## 解决方案:
我们可以使用Py
原创
2023-07-22 06:24:33
1211阅读
# Python中Tab的输出问题解决方案
在Python编程中,对数据进行格式化输出是一项重要的任务。尤其是在处理大型文本数据或生成易读的报告时,使用制表符(Tab)进行格式化输出可以使得结果更加清晰。在这篇文章中,我们将探讨如何在Python中正确输出制表符,并通过具体示例展示其应用。
## Tab的使用场景
制表符在Python中通常被用于以下场景:
1. **文本输出格式化**:在
原创
2024-10-31 08:20:09
90阅读